"DESPITE predictions that Manny Pacquiao would win by a knockout when he battles World Boxing Council lightweight champion David Diaz at the Mandalay Bay Resort Hotel and Casino in Las Vegas on June 28, Top Rank promoter Bob Arum said it won’t be an easy fight. Among those who said Pacquiao would win by a knockout was former WBC super-featherweight champion Juan Manuel Marquez, who lost his title to the Pacman by a split decision last March 15 on the same card, where Diaz beat the Filipino’s sparring partner Ramon Montano by a 10-round majority decision. In an interview on the dzSR Sports Radio show “Sports Chat,” hosted by journalist and “Main Event” TV show boxing analyst Dennis Principe, Arum said: “It’s impossible to KO Diaz. He is one of those over-achieving fighters.”
